Simpson completes Motocross of Nations team
By TMX Archives on 29th Sep 09

Newly appointed Motocross of Nations Team Manager Steve Dixon made his decision on the final rider line-up for the coveted event this weekend in Franciacorta Italy.
Tommy Searle, Billy MacKenzie and Shaun Simpson are the definitive line up. Simpson isreplacing the injured Carl Nunn who sustained a broken leg during a recent racemeeting.
Simpson stepped up to MX1 at the final round of the Maxxis Championshipat Landrake where he pulled in a second place finish during the firstmoto.
Dixon explained his decision saying: "I've considered his resultsabroad as well as his British results and that is why I've decided togo with Shaun Simpson. He proved here at Landrake that he can ride a450. It's a shame Billy accidently took him down in the second moto butI saw what happened and I watched him come back through the pack.Stephen Sword, James Noble and Jake Nicholls also had brilliant racesso it was a very tough decision considering I've just acquired the jobthree weeks ago. I think we are in a good position so I want everyoneto get behind the team and support us as we go for a podium. I think wewill do well as we have a strong team.”
The Red Bull Motocross of Nations will take place on Sunday 4th October at Franciacorta in Italy.
